Understanding the Basics: What You Need to Know
So, what exactly *is* an online casino? Think of it as a virtual version of a traditional casino, but instead of walking into a building, you access it via your computer or mobile device. These platforms offer a wide array of games, including:
- Pokies (Slots): These are the most popular games, featuring spinning reels and various themes. You simply spin the reels and hope for a winning combination.
- Table Games: This includes classics like bl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ker. You’ll play against the computer (or sometimes, a live dealer).
- Live Dealer Games: These games stream a real-life dealer to your screen, creating a more immersive experience. You can interact with the dealer and other players in real-time.
- Specialty Games: These can include things like Keno, scratch cards, and bingo.
Before you start, you’ll need a few things: a computer or mobile device, a stable internet connection, and a registered account with an online casino. You’ll also need to deposit some funds to play, usually via credit card, debit card, e-wallet, or bank transfer. Always remember to gamble responsibly and only spend what you can afford to lose.
Choosing a Safe and Reputable Online Casino
This is arguably the most important step. With so many online casinos out there, it’s crucial to choose one that’s safe, secure, and trustworthy. Here’s what to look for:
Licensing and Regulation
A reputable online casino will be licensed and regulated by a recognised authority. This ensures that the casino ad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ling. Check the casino’s website for its licensing information; it’s usually displayed at the bottom of the page.
Security Measures
Look for casinos that use encryption technology (like SSL) to protect your personal and financial information. This ensures that your data is kept safe and secure. Also, check for a privacy policy to understand how the casino handles your data.
Game Fairness
The games should be independently tested and audited by third-party organisations to ensure fairness. These organisations use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ure that the game outcomes are truly random and unbiased. Look for logos of these testing agencies on the casino’s website.
Payment Options
A good online casino will offer a variety of safe and convenient payment options, including cred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(like PayPal, Neteller, or Skrill), and bank transfers. Check the casino’s terms and conditions regarding deposit and withdrawal limits, as well as processing times.
Customer Support
Excellent customer support is a sign of a reputable casino. Look for casinos that offer 24/7 customer support via live chat, email, or phone. Test their support by asking a question before you sign up to see how responsive and helpful they are.
Playing Responsibly: Staying in Control
Online gambling should be fun and entertaining, but it’s important to gamble responsibly to avoid potential problems. Here are some tips:
Set a Budget
Before you start playing, decide how much money you’re willing to spend and stick to it. Never chase your losses or gamble with money you can’t afford to lose.
Set Time Limits
Establish how much time you’ll spend gambling and stick to it. Take breaks regularly to avoid getting carried away.
Know Your Limits
Recognise the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money or time than you intended, gambling to escape problems, or neglecting responsibilities. If you feel you have a problem, seek help from organisations like Gambling Help Online or Lifeline.
Use Responsible Gambling Tools
Many online casinos offer responsible gambling tools,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Use these tools to stay in control.
